Dr. Min Wang, MD, is currently a research fellow at Mayo Clinic with appointment in the Department of Cardiovascular Diseases. He earned his MD from China. After 3 years research training in a lab of cardiac functional studies at the University of Cincinnati, he joined Dr. Richard Weinshilboum and Dr. Naveen Pereira (cardiology clinician) joint lab and started his research training in cardiovascular pharmacogenomics studies. He has presented his research work at scientific meetings, such as annal meetings of American Heart Association (AHA), European Society of Cardiology (ESC) and American College of Cardiology (ACC) and has published original research papers in this area. To broaden his horizons, enrich his experiences and keep his knowledges updated, Dr. Weinshilboum encouraged him to join ASCPT. Dr. Wang is currently working on several pharmacogenomic research projects to identify biomarkers and pharmaco-therapeutic strategies for heart failure.
